2. Research local Organizations


Bloomington is home for a number of non-profit organizations and charitable foundations that constantly seek volunteers. Start your search by exploring the local nonprofits and charities working in the fields you're interested. There are a variety of resources to locate potential opportunities to offer your services:


  • United Way of McLean County: This organization will help you find volunteering opportunities that are in line with your interests and the skills you have.

  • Bloomington Public Library Sometimes, the local library will have details or bulletin boards which include adverts for volunteer positions.

  • volunteer opportunities in Bloomington-Normal Bloomington's official website: Check the local city's government's website to see community projects and programs that rely on volunteers.

  • volunteer opportunities in Bloomington Illinois Local Schools and Colleges: Educational institutions often require volunteers for different activities that include event organizing and tutoring.

  • Religious Organisations: Many churches, synagogues, mosques, and synagogues offer outreach and community service programs.

Step 3: Make use of online Platforms


Several online platforms can help you find volunteering opportunities in Bloomington. Sites such as VolunteerMatch.org as well as Idealist.org will allow you to browse for potential opportunities based on your locations and preferences. These websites can be advantageous for discovering specific tasks that require your unique skills or your interests.
